Output 104a29d64b00ab2f37c4dcf01e52a04f78cc653952036e4324b73e0b2c81bba4:0

value
21272
script pubkey
OP_0 OP_PUSHBYTES_20 4098865d53561c3d5fbc184eff72270329943c54
address
bc1qgzvgvh2n2cwr6haurp807u38qv5eg0z565f8e4
transaction
104a29d64b00ab2f37c4dcf01e52a04f78cc653952036e4324b73e0b2c81bba4
confirmations
89792
spent
true